超市连锁店信息系统分析与设计之欧阳物创编Word格式.docx
《超市连锁店信息系统分析与设计之欧阳物创编Word格式.docx》由会员分享,可在线阅读,更多相关《超市连锁店信息系统分析与设计之欧阳物创编Word格式.docx(14页珍藏版)》请在冰豆网上搜索。
撰写前言参与调研
涂乐君
2010500105
协助撰写正文、作业排版
陈宇龙
2010500096
协助撰写正文、协助表格制作
余宜婷
2010500095
协助撰写正文
超市连锁店管理系统分析概述1
系统需求分析5
新系统的逻辑方案设计5
数据库设计13
一、概述
(一)开发背景
中百超市连锁店以其"
低价无假货"
的经营宗旨,成为湖北省规模最大、网点最广,最具影响力的大型连锁超市。
采用统一采购,统一核算,统一配送的低成本经营方式。
至今已开办5000--12000平方米仓储式大卖场60家,500--2000平方米便民超市400余家,主要经营食品、日用百货、家用电器、文体用品、服装鞋帽等大类商品。
我们研究的对象是该超市连锁店在武汉工程大学流芳校区的一个分店,其规模属于中型超市。
因其经营规模的扩大,业务的扩张,欲占有本校超市更大份额,必须引进先进的管理思想、方法和技术,以提高企业的管理水平。
为此,本小组选择本超市作为研究对象,对其进行信息系统的研究,试图进行提高商品库存效率,增加公司年度利润。
(二)系统目标和开发可行性
1、系统目标
本系统开发混合采用结构化系统开发方法与面向对象的开发方法,结合两种开发方法各自的优势进行系统开发。
对原来的库存管理系统进行改进,使之能为公司提供强大的管理支持和查询服务,具体完成以下功能:
✧库存输入
✧库存修改
✧库存查询
✧库存处理
2、系统开发的可行性
(1)技术的可行性
要求系统开发人员能够熟练运用VB、VF等编程语言,并需要计算机一台。
目前本小组成员已经基本掌握这些编程语言,小组成员有多台电脑可供使用。
因此,本此系统开发在技术上是可行的。
(2)时间可行性
开发时间约需要一个月左右。
本月前两周主要用于系统分析、设计、实现,后面的时间用于调试。
(3)经济可行性
现在已有一部分计算机等所需设备,可以充分发挥作用,节约设备资金,基本不需其他研究费用。
(4)人员可行性
所需人员5人,其中有系统分析员、系统设计员、程序员等,同时还有超市走访调研工作。
(三)组织结构分析
超市的主要决策和管理机构是董事会。
董事会分管各连锁店经理和配送中心;
配送中心在超市的经营中所扮演的角色是给货品不足的各连锁店补充货品,相对来说,此部门是相对独立的;
连锁店由专职经理负责,每家连锁店分为库存管理部、销售部、财务部三个主要部门。
库存管理部的主要任务是根据销售部提供的信息和配送中心及时联系,使库房货源充足;
责任货物的接收,并安排好货物的存放事宜;
对每天进出库房的货物进行详细记录,使基础数据完备。
销售部主要责任日常销售工作,包括物品摆放、货架整理、收银台等货物销售区的日常事务;
及时准确地将销售信息反馈给其他部门,以保证商品的及时供应更新;
同时处理消费者提出的各种疑问和信息,为公司的整体运作提供实际销售的基础数据。
财务部负责一切与财务有关的各项事宜,全面记录公司的所有收支资金流动,包括各种收入、支出、税务、财务结算等。
对进出贷款实行控制,定期分析资金走向,为公司的发展计划做好准备。
二、系统需求分析
☆现行系统的业务描述
在现行系统中,销售部在销售货物时发现某种商品不足,根据这种商品的销售量及时制制订货品需求计划,送至库存管理部。
库存管理部检查这种商品的存货量,如果储货不足则制订进货计划,交给连锁店经理审批。
经理批准后,告知财务部提款。
库存管理部与配送中心联系,然后接收存储货物,并送至销售部进行销售。
三、新系统的逻辑方案设计
(一)新系统拟定的管理方法及管理制度
原系统中销售部人员根据对货架上商品数量的检查,人工地向库存管理部提供需求计划。
库存管理人员也是通过对存货量人工地检查发现缺货后,发传真至货物配送中心。
再原系统中采用的管理方法都是比较落后的,只适用于小型超市。
随着超市规模的发展,该超市已经发展成为一家中型超市。
原系统已经不能适用于该超市。
我们在新系统设计方案中将做以下修改。
为了适应市场的需要,使企业效益更好,我们设计的新超市管理系统,利用计算机管理,处理货品需求信息,设立库存量底限,货存不足时由系统自动提出。
新系统的组织结构如图1所示,在超市连锁分店中添加信息部,主要负责分析商品的的销售情况,并且通过调查及时获得新商品的信息,提供给库存管理部。
其他管理都与原系统一样。
图1新系统组织结构图
(二)新系统拟定的业务流程
新系统的业务流程主要是多了信息部的业务环节。
在当今信息社会,商品信息对超市非常重要。
信息部专门负责收集商品信息,经处理后,做出市场预测及新商品的需求分析。
这样可以弥补原系统信息滞后的缺点。
同时,有利于高层决策者据此做出正确决策,及时调整计划。
如图所示,销售部将销售数据通过新系统传给库存管理部,库存管理部对库存进行检查并处理,提交进行计划。
同时,信息部收集信息,对新产品进行需求分析,制订出新产品的进货计划并提交。
经连锁店批准后,经财务部记账,提款。
库存管理部发送进货信息,接货并存储,把产品送至销售部销售。
图2新系统库存管理业务流程图
(三)新系统拟定的数据与数据流程分析
新系统拟定的库存处理数据流程图如图3所示。
图3新系统拟定的库存处理数据流程顶层图
新系统中增设了信息部。
信息部向库存管理部提供商品需求及市场预测信息。
库存管理部据此列出新定的商品,再对此进行检查处理,将订单传至配送中心。
库存管理部接受配送中心送来的货物,进行库存处理。
库存处理后,生成库存数据并存储,将现行库存商品现行反馈至销售部。
对于超市原来已经引进的商品,由计算机控制库存。
当库存量达到系统所设定的底线时,系统将自动提示库存管理人员订货。
具体处理过程如图1-9所示。
图4新系统拟定的库存处理数据流程一层图
(四)新系统拟定的数据字典分析
1、数据流的描述
编号
名称
来源
去向
数据项组成
流量
高峰流量
D-01
订货细则
补充商品模块
检查处理模块
商品名称+商品数量+商品价格+日期+总金额+经手人
约30张/日
约50张/日
D-02
销售清单
销售部
清单编号+商品数量+商品价格+日期+总金额+经手人
D-03
订货单
配送中心
订货单编号+日期+产品代码+产品名称+产品数量+单价+订货金额+单位+时间+经手人
D-04
发货通知(库存充足)
发货单编号+日期+产品代码+产品名称+产品数量+单价+单位+时间+经手人
D-05
补货单
批准的补货数据
补货单编号+日期+商代码+商名称+产品数量+单价+补货金额+单位+时间+经手人
D-06
送货单
库存处理模块
商品代码+商品名称+商品数量+单价+单位+时间+经手人
D-07
发货通知
发货单编号+日期+商品代码+商品名称+商品数量+单价+单位+时间+经手人
2、数据存储的描述
F-01
商品数据
记录商品信息
商品名称+商品价格+商品条码+商品需求量
P-01
F-02
记录批准的补货商品信息
商品名称+商品价格+商品条码+商品补货量+补货金额
P-02,P-03
F-03
库存数据
记录超市库存商品信息
商品名称+商品价格+商品条码+商品库存量+日期
P-03
F-04
商品条码
记录所有商品的条码信息
商品名称+商品价格+商品条码
P-04
3、处理的逻辑描述
处理逻辑编号
处理逻辑名称
简述
输入的数据流
处理描述
输出的数据流
处理频率
补充商品
综合商品需求和市场信息信息确定需要补充的商品
市场信息
库存管理部综合商品需求信息和市场初步确定需要补充的商品。
30次/日
P-02
检查处理
对现有库存商品检查处理
对现有库存量进行检查后再确定是否进货。
若库存充足,则无需进货,直接送货至销售部;
若库存不足,则通过一定程序批准补充货物,将订单传至配送中心。
发货通知;
库存信息补货计划
库存处理
接受配送货物进行库存处理
进货单
库存信息
提供现有商品信息
生成库存商品信息并配送
库存处理后,生成库存数据并存储,将现行库存商品信息反馈至销售部
商品信息
4、外部实体的描述
外部实体编号
外部实体名称
S-01
信息部
向库存管理部提供商品需求及市场预测信息
S-02
将销售数据通过新系统传给库存管理部
S-03
为库存管理部配送货物
四、数据库设计
本系统采用DBASE建立了两个数据库,一是人事档案管理数据库,另一个是库存管理数据库。
人事档案管理数据库的表结构如表4.1所示。
表4.1职工人事档案的结构表
字段名
类型
宽度
小数位数
索引
说明
职工编号
字符型
6
有
编号规则见表2-2
8
性别
2
男、女
出生日期
年月日
民族
籍贯
16
省(直辖市)、市(区)
家庭住址
36
政治面貌
10
文化程度
小学、初中、高中、大学、研究生等
健康状况
良好、一般等
婚姻状况
4
已婚、未婚、离异、丧偶等
参加工作日期
日期型
进本单位日期
数值型
工资
基本工资
各种补贴
部门
现任职务
职号
3
职务编号
权限
1
系统使用权限具体内容:
1-系统管理员;
2-一般用户……
电话
12
备注
备注型
库存管理数据库中含有出库表、入库表和库存表,这三个表的数据结构如表
4.2、表4.3和表4.4所示。
表4.2出库表
商品编号
文本
13
编号规则见表2-1
数量
数字
整型
经手人
买家
出库日期/时间
日期/
时间
常规日期(年月日/时分秒)
表4.3入库表
供应商
50
数值
单价
货币
自动
入库日期/时间
日期/时间
表4.4库存表
商品名称
分类
A,B,C类
单位
计量单位